Men's Mental Health and why 'It Ain't Weak to Speak' with Sam Webb, Actor and Co-Founder of LIVIN


Listen Later

WARNING: This episode discusses suicide. If you or anyone you know needs help, reach out and talk to somebody.

Divorce and Separation is the second highest contributing factor in suicide in men. It's time to raise the awareness and support men through this season in their life and remind them and us that #itaintweaktospeak.

Today's guest is Sam Webb. Sam is well known in Australia for his appearances on TV. Most people will recognise Sam as an actor on Neighbours or for his appearance on Australian Survivor, a host on Nine’s Great Escapes and was one of the subject leaders on the feature film documentary, Suicide: The Ripple Effect which won top awards in the United States.

In 2013 Sam's life took a u-turn when his good friend Dwayne Lally took his life. Together Sam and Casey Lyons co-founded the mental health organisation and charity, LIVIN. The core of their mission is to end the stigma around mental health through education, fashion and community. 

Nikki and Sam dive into - 

  • The difference in stigma between men and women’s mental health.
  • How we as a community/society can encourage men to talk about their mental health.
  • Ways of getting the men in our lives to seek support.
  • What it’s like inside a male brain when your mental health is suffering.
  • Tips for partners of men when you are concerned about their mental health.
  • Tips for parents to support their young men.
